Netlify
tcp/443
Exposing Swagger/OpenAPI documentation is primarily a risk if your API has underlying security flaws, as it gives attackers a precise roadmap to find them.
Those detail every endpoint, parameter, and data model, making it easier to discover and exploit vulnerabilities like broken access control or injection points.
While a perfectly secure API mitigates the danger, protecting your documentation is a critical layer of defense that forces attackers to work without a map.
Severity: info
Fingerprint: 5733ddf49ff49cd1bf890109bf890109bf890109bf890109bf890109bf890109
Public Swagger UI/API detected at path: /api-docs/swagger.json
Open service 35.157.26.135:443 · nodeapi.nihalshameem.com
2026-01-09 22:56
HTTP/1.1 404 Not Found Age: 1 Cache-Control: no-cache Cache-Status: "Netlify Durable"; fwd=bypass Cache-Status: "Netlify Edge"; fwd=miss Content-Security-Policy: default-src 'none' Content-Type: text/html; charset=utf-8 Date: Fri, 09 Jan 2026 22:56:24 GMT Netlify-Vary: query Server: Netlify Strict-Transport-Security: max-age=31536000 Vary: Origin X-Content-Type-Options: nosniff X-Nf-Request-Id: 01KEJFKA90VJ7QE4MMBAR7KT4E X-Powered-By: Express Connection: close Transfer-Encoding: chunked Page title: Error <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>Error</title> </head> <body> <pre>Cannot GET /</pre> </body> </html>
Open service 35.157.26.135:443 · nodeapi.nihalshameem.com
2025-12-30 12:02
HTTP/1.1 404 Not Found Age: 1 Cache-Control: no-cache Cache-Status: "Netlify Durable"; fwd=bypass Cache-Status: "Netlify Edge"; fwd=miss Content-Security-Policy: default-src 'none' Content-Type: text/html; charset=utf-8 Date: Tue, 30 Dec 2025 12:02:45 GMT Netlify-Vary: query Server: Netlify Strict-Transport-Security: max-age=31536000 Vary: Origin X-Content-Type-Options: nosniff X-Nf-Request-Id: 01KDQJ780805TKDG3X6PY9G8H4 X-Powered-By: Express Connection: close Transfer-Encoding: chunked Page title: Error <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>Error</title> </head> <body> <pre>Cannot GET /</pre> </body> </html>
Open service 35.157.26.135:443 · nodeapi.nihalshameem.com
2025-12-22 13:24
HTTP/1.1 404 Not Found Age: 2 Cache-Control: no-cache Cache-Status: "Netlify Durable"; fwd=bypass Cache-Status: "Netlify Edge"; fwd=miss Content-Security-Policy: default-src 'none' Content-Type: text/html; charset=utf-8 Date: Mon, 22 Dec 2025 13:24:44 GMT Netlify-Vary: query Server: Netlify Strict-Transport-Security: max-age=31536000 Vary: Origin X-Content-Type-Options: nosniff X-Nf-Request-Id: 01KD33QK0GRX0DG7CN06JS5626 X-Powered-By: Express Connection: close Transfer-Encoding: chunked Page title: Error <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>Error</title> </head> <body> <pre>Cannot GET /</pre> </body> </html>
Open service 35.157.26.135:443 · nodeapi.nihalshameem.com
2025-12-20 14:09
HTTP/1.1 404 Not Found Age: 1 Cache-Control: no-cache Cache-Status: "Netlify Durable"; fwd=bypass Cache-Status: "Netlify Edge"; fwd=miss Content-Security-Policy: default-src 'none' Content-Type: text/html; charset=utf-8 Date: Sat, 20 Dec 2025 14:09:45 GMT Netlify-Vary: query Server: Netlify Strict-Transport-Security: max-age=31536000 Vary: Origin X-Content-Type-Options: nosniff X-Nf-Request-Id: 01KCY1GK79BYB1S81VR70WKXSA X-Powered-By: Express Connection: close Transfer-Encoding: chunked Page title: Error <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>Error</title> </head> <body> <pre>Cannot GET /</pre> </body> </html>